Types of Hobs Available
There are various types of hobs available in the market, each had its distinct benefits.
Gas Hobs
Gas hobs are popular among cooking enthusiasts since they supply direct flame control. Here are some characteristics:
Instant Heat: Gas offers instant heat, permitting accurate temperature level control.Visual Flame: The visual flame provides users an indication of the heat level.Compatibility: Works oven with hob numerous kinds of pots and pans.Electric Hobs
Electric hobs consist of several sub-types, including solid plate, glowing, and glass-ceramic. Key features include:
Smooth Surface: Easy to clean and preserve.Consistent Heat: Provides an even cooking temperature.Variety in Styles: Available in various styles to fit kitchen aesthetics.Induction Hobs
Induction hobs are becoming increasingly popular due to their energy effectiveness and security features. These hobs:

Q3: Can I use any pots and pans on induction hobs?A3: No, induction hobs need ferrous(magnetic)pots and pans. Examine for compatibility before acquiring.
